SEC’s Silence Raises Questions
As of March 30, the crypto market is still awaiting an official statement from the SEC confirming the withdrawal of its appeal against XRP. Ripple CEO Brad Garlinghouse announced the SEC’s decision on March 19, 2025. The SEC had previously dismissed its case against cryptocurrency exchange Coinbase shortly after CEO Brian Armstrong expressed confidence about the matter. This recent SEC silence has redirected attention towards an internal investigation led by the Office of Inspector General (OIG), which is looking into alleged conflicts of interest related to cryptocurrency regulations within the agency.
John E. Deaton, attorney and representative for 75,000 XRP holders in the Ripple case, emphasized the need for transparency related to past transgressions. He called for the SEC to release the OIG’s findings regarding former SEC director William Hinman, who delivered the controversial "Ether Speech" in 2018. The investigation had been initiated after allegations from Empower Oversight, a government watchdog, raised concerns about potential conflicts of interest involving Hinman and his former law firm, Simpson Thacher, which is affiliated with Ethereum.
The Importance of the OIG Investigation
Hinman’s declaration that Bitcoin (BTC) and Ethereum (ETH) were not securities significantly affected the competitive landscape between these cryptocurrencies and XRP. Critics argue that it negatively impacted XRP’s market position. Documents related to Hinman’s speeches revealed ongoing interactions with Simpson Thacher while he was still with the SEC, raising further questions about the integrity of the SEC’s actions.
Despite the OIG’s findings being completed and submitted to the SEC in December, which were kept undisclosed under former SEC Chair Gary Gensler, calls for transparency have intensified. Deaton has urged the media to apply pressure on the SEC for public disclosure of these findings. Increased transparency could enhance investor confidence in the SEC’s evolving regulatory approach towards digital assets.
XRP’s Price Movements and Market Sentiment
On March 30, XRP managed to break a five-day losing streak, gaining 0.13% to close at $2.0922, even as it ended the week down 12.43%. This price movement occurred amid broader market pressures, including rising tariffs and inflation concerns within the U.S. economy, which have adversely affected risk assets, including cryptocurrencies. The total cryptocurrency market capitalization fell by 4.99% to $2.63 trillion in the week finishing March 30. The outlook for XRP remains tied to several factors, particularly the ongoing SEC vs. Ripple litigation. Key elements influencing XRP’s future include the resolution of the court case, prospects for an XRP spot ETF (with 18 applications pending review), and broader macroeconomic conditions that may impact risk sentiment and trading volumes.
Bitcoin’s Struggles in a Volatile Market
XRP’s price stability mirrors the recent struggles of Bitcoin, which continued to decline, losing 0.36% on March 30 and hitting a low of $82,405. Bitcoin’s falling trend follows a three-day losing streak amid concerns about upcoming trade tariffs and fluctuating monetary policies. The Nasdaq Composite Index also reflected this trend, which fell by 2.59%.
In March 2025, Senator Cynthia Lummis reintroduced the Bitcoin Act, proposing significant government acquisitions of Bitcoin over five years. However, Bitcoin’s recent volatility raises questions about its reliability as a reserve asset, potentially impacting future legislative support.
